I might be jumping the gun with this [not enough info about your design requirements]
This "drive mechanism" thingo - if you can scrounge the hub from an electric bike, you might be able to lace it into the centre of the front wheel.
Then you could have your pilot almost prone in the seat - lowering the C.O.G, giving much less drag than an upright pilot, and your boom can be much lower- giving more sail area.

Totally agree "landyacht" with the mast height restrictions they are going to need LOTS of square meters of sail (that can only go out sideways) to launch you 100mtrs.
13m/s is 25knots, so I would aim at being less elegant, with a simple 5.5m2 area sail and blitz the high tech field. Who are just getting their wing to work at the 100mtr mark.
It wont need to be very well mannered for just 100mtrs. ![]()
